Larry M. Regalado
Oxnard, CA
Larry M. Regalado passed away peacefully on October 21, 2017 after a lengthy Illness. He was born and raised in Oxnard, California to Leonard Regalado and Ruth Madrid Regalado.
After graduating from Oxnard High School, he proudly served his country in the Korean War as a member of the Air Force from 1951-1955. Upon returning from his service, he began working at Camarillo State Hospital as a mail clerk where he retired in 1997.
Dad was a kind and loving man who enjoyed having fun, playing cards and was an avid poker player at Players Casino in Ventura. He enjoyed watching sports and attending all of his Grandchildren's sporting events, and was fortunate enough to attend his Great Grandchildren's events as well. He was our #1 fan!
Larry was preceded in death by his mom and dad, his two sons, Phillip and Peter Estrada. He is Survived by his sons, Richard Estrada, Ron Regalado (Jeanette), Larry Regalado, Daughter, Rhonda Regalado Navarro, Sisters Sally Rivas and Rachel Garcia (Abel). 10 Grandchildren an 14 Great Grandchildren.
A celebration of life will be held on Friday November 3,2017 at 6:00 P.M. at Perez Family Funeral Home located at 1347 Del Norte Rd, Camarillo CA 93010
